The ingredients needed to prepare Kabocha Rice Made in Rice Cooker:
- You need 500 ml rice
- Get 750 ml water
- You need pinch salt
- Get 1 tbsp oil (I used fermented garlic & candlenut oil)
- Prepare 1 cup peeled and diced kabocha
- You need 2 tbsp dry sliced garlic (you can use fresh garlic, of course)
Steps to make Kabocha Rice Made in Rice Cooker:
- Combine all ingredients in rice cooker. Stir if necessary.
- Press COOK and wait until it's done!
